Obverse description View of the Adolphe Bridge spanning the Pétrusse valley in Luxembourg City, with the European Parliament building and surrounding landscape visible in the background. The commemorative inscription noting the 40th anniversary of the European Parliament appears in the upper field, with the issuer name LUXEMBOURG below. The denomination of 5 ECU and the date 1992 are prominently displayed in the lower portion of the field, alongside the designation MEDAILLE DE.

Reverse description Portrait bust of Charles IV, Count of Luxembourg, King of Bohemia, and Holy Roman Emperor (1316–1378), facing right and wearing an imperial crown. The effigy is rendered in a detailed medallic style befitting his multiple royal and imperial dignities. A circular legend surrounding the portrait identifies the subject with his full titulature in French. The mint mark CHI appears in the lower field.
